Summary

Our See & Spray Team is looking for a highly motivated Hardware Assembly Technician to deliver the promise of Precision Agriculture to the world’s farm fields. In this role, you will collaborate with our team in the development, testing, and optimization of hardware systems that power our agricultural and construction equipment. We tackle our objectives with multi-functional engineering teams of systems and embedded software, test and QA, mechatronics, computer vision and machine learning engineers. Our team is empowered to figure out how to overcome challenges, and plan and prioritize work – everyone is a key contributor.

  • Employment Type: Temporary contract (6-month contract)
  • Work Location: On-site in Santa Clara, CA.
  • Visa sponsorship is not available for this role.

Job Responsibilities

The primary job responsibilities include the following:

  • Design, build, test, and assemble hardware components and assemblies.
  • Follow technical drawings, schematics, and assembly instructions to put together hardware systems.
  • Perform tests to ensure the assembled hardware is functioning properly.
  • Prepare, package, and ship equipment in accordance with verbal and written procedures.
  • Conduct quality checks to ensure that the hardware meets quality standards and specifications.
  • Troubleshoot hardware assemblies to identify and resolve issues.
  • Utilize a variety of tools and equipment to perform fabrication, assembly, and testing tasks.
  • Track and document work processes.

Required Experience and Skills

  • BS degree or equivalent experience in mechatronics, mechanical/electrical technology, or related field.
  • 4 or more years of experience with electromechanical systems.
  • Experience safely operating machining equipment, including mills, lathes, saws, and lasers.
  • Ability to work effectively in a fast-paced, iterative development environment.
  • Strong written and verbal documentation to follow, interpret, and draft technical documentation.

Preferred Experience and Skills

  • Experience developing g-code for CNC equipment.
  • Familiarity with SSH for remote access and scripting on single board compute for rapid prototype/test applications (i.e., Raspberry Pi use cases).
  • Passionate about agriculture.

Blue River offers competitive compensation for temporary positions. This role is expected to pay $40–$50 per hour, depending on experience.
